What The Whipping Boy is like to read

A brisk, comic adventure in which a street-smart whipping boy and a spoiled prince tumble through highway perils and grudging friendship. Short, propulsive chapters and broad humor keep it light while a real tenderness sneaks in. Best for: middle-grade readers who want a short, funny historical adventure with a big heart.

Bud, Not Buddy cover
Bud, Not Buddy
Christopher Paul Curtis · 2001
A funny, plucky first-person voice carries a Depression-era orphan's quest across Michigan — laugh-out-loud rules-of-life asides balanced with real ache about a missing family, resolving in a warm, earned reunion.

Johnny Tremain cover
Johnny Tremain
Esther Forbes · 1943
A vivid, brisk historical adventure that grounds Revolutionary Boston in the sweat of an apprentice's workshop — Johnny's prideful arrogance gets humbled by injury before he finds his place among the Sons of Liberty.
